NOTES: 1. WHAT IS A TURNKEY CONTRACT? A Turnkey Contract is one under which the contractor is responsible for both the design and construction of a facility. The basic concept is that in a Turnkey Contract the contractor shall provide the works ready for use at the agreed price and by a fixed date.
